Christopher is stunned when he discovers a Way-Between from our world to the Archipelago: a cluster of magical islands where all the creatures of myth still live and breed and thrive in their thousands. There he meets Mal: a girl from the islands, who is in possession of a flying coat and a baby griffin, and who is being pursued by a killer. Together they embark on an urgent quest to discover why the creatures are suddenly perishing, voyaging across the wild splendour of the Archipelago, where sphinxes hold secrets and centaurs do murder, in a bid to save both the islands and the world beyond them from a rising evil - before it's too late. *Please note the book cover you receive may be different from the one that is shown * THE TIMES CHILDREN'S BOOK OF THE WEEK * THE INDEPENDENT CHILDREN'S BOOK OF THE WEEK * THE DAILY TELEGRAPH CHILDREN'S BOOK OF THE WEEK * SUNDAY TIMES BESTSELLER IN SEPTEMBER 2023 * BRITISH BOOK AWARDS CHILDREN'S FICTION BOOK OF THE YEAR * WATERSTONES BOOK OF THE YEAR WINNER * BOOKS ARE MY BAG READERS' AWARD WINNER * FOYLES CHILDREN'S BOOK OF THE YEAR * SHORTLISTED FOR desertcart KIDS AND YA BOOK OF THE YEAR 'Full of adventures, wonderful side characters, new lands and so many fantastic creatures. Review: Magical adventure book with depth and heart - Outstanding. I listened on audible and the narration is wonderful. It’s worth listening to an interview with Rundell to understand her reasons for writing this and for writing for children aged 9-ish, as this adds another layer of depth and beauty. It’s a wonderful magical adventure story, with real depth and feeling. I’m a massive fan! FYI it’s sad at times and I (an adult) gasped and cried so careful with young/sensitive children. (Similar to Harry Potter books in darker themes).
